The meaning of Rocketed
Rocketed – definition
verb(of an amount, price, etc.) increase very rapidly and suddenly.

Word origin
early 17th century: from French roquette, from Italian rocchetto, diminutive of rocca ‘distaff (for spinning)’, with reference to its cylindrical shape.
